Partilhar via


NetworkInterfacesOperations interface

Interface que representa uma operação NetworkInterfaces.

Propriedades

createOrUpdate

A operação para criar ou atualizar uma interface de rede. Observe que algumas propriedades podem ser definidas somente durante a criação da interface de rede.

delete
get

Obtém uma interface de rede

listAll

Lista todas as interfaces de rede na assinatura especificada. Use a propriedade nextLink na resposta para obter a próxima página de interfaces de rede.

listByResourceGroup

Lista todas as interfaces de rede no grupo de recursos especificado. Use a propriedade nextLink na resposta para obter a próxima página de interfaces de rede.

update

A operação para atualizar uma interface de rede.

Detalhes de Propriedade

createOrUpdate

A operação para criar ou atualizar uma interface de rede. Observe que algumas propriedades podem ser definidas somente durante a criação da interface de rede.

createOrUpdate: (resourceGroupName: string, networkInterfaceName: string, resource: NetworkInterface, options?: NetworkInterfacesCreateOrUpdateOptionalParams) => PollerLike<OperationState<NetworkInterface>, NetworkInterface>

Valor de Propriedade

(resourceGroupName: string, networkInterfaceName: string, resource: NetworkInterface, options?: NetworkInterfacesCreateOrUpdateOptionalParams) => PollerLike<OperationState<NetworkInterface>, NetworkInterface>

delete

delete: (resourceGroupName: string, networkInterfaceName: string, options?: NetworkInterfacesDeleteOptionalParams) => PollerLike<OperationState<void>, void>

Valor de Propriedade

(resourceGroupName: string, networkInterfaceName: string, options?: NetworkInterfacesDeleteOptionalParams) => PollerLike<OperationState<void>, void>

get

Obtém uma interface de rede

get: (resourceGroupName: string, networkInterfaceName: string, options?: NetworkInterfacesGetOptionalParams) => Promise<NetworkInterface>

Valor de Propriedade

(resourceGroupName: string, networkInterfaceName: string, options?: NetworkInterfacesGetOptionalParams) => Promise<NetworkInterface>

listAll

Lista todas as interfaces de rede na assinatura especificada. Use a propriedade nextLink na resposta para obter a próxima página de interfaces de rede.

listAll: (options?: NetworkInterfacesListAllOptionalParams) => PagedAsyncIterableIterator<NetworkInterface, NetworkInterface[], PageSettings>

Valor de Propriedade

(options?: NetworkInterfacesListAllOptionalParams) => PagedAsyncIterableIterator<NetworkInterface, NetworkInterface[], PageSettings>

listByResourceGroup

Lista todas as interfaces de rede no grupo de recursos especificado. Use a propriedade nextLink na resposta para obter a próxima página de interfaces de rede.

listByResourceGroup: (resourceGroupName: string, options?: NetworkInterfacesListByResourceGroupOptionalParams) => PagedAsyncIterableIterator<NetworkInterface, NetworkInterface[], PageSettings>

Valor de Propriedade

(resourceGroupName: string, options?: NetworkInterfacesListByResourceGroupOptionalParams) => PagedAsyncIterableIterator<NetworkInterface, NetworkInterface[], PageSettings>

update

A operação para atualizar uma interface de rede.

update: (resourceGroupName: string, networkInterfaceName: string, properties: NetworkInterfacesUpdateRequest, options?: NetworkInterfacesUpdateOptionalParams) => PollerLike<OperationState<NetworkInterface>, NetworkInterface>

Valor de Propriedade

(resourceGroupName: string, networkInterfaceName: string, properties: NetworkInterfacesUpdateRequest, options?: NetworkInterfacesUpdateOptionalParams) => PollerLike<OperationState<NetworkInterface>, NetworkInterface>